Meanings
-
1
adj
able to use both hands with equal skill
He is ambidextrous and can write with both hands.
-
2
adj
versatile or adaptable in a particular context
Her ambidextrous approach to problem-solving impressed the team.

Etymology
From Latin ambi- ('both') + dexter ('right-handed'), forming ambidexter ('right-handed on both sides'); via Old French ambidextre into Early Modern English (16th c.) ambidextrous ('able to use both hands with equal skill').
